Output 75969a05b34298e67a5c942129cbe2d4e410faaa0d6a00597be05068cc5d0bec:5

value
50750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a8d1941fcaff6f3b8537e85a88da357499b72f OP_EQUAL
address
3CWRtuX8KtGcoYWNteJC1ELooGtFJvYrvg
transaction
75969a05b34298e67a5c942129cbe2d4e410faaa0d6a00597be05068cc5d0bec
confirmations
84429
spent
true